#ifndef RV_MAP_H
#define RV_MAP_H
#include "rvtree.h"
#define rvDeclareMap(K, V) \
typedef struct { RvTree tree; } _RvMap##K##V; \
typedef RvTreeIter _RvMapIter##K##V; \
typedef RvTreeRevIter _RvMapRevIter##K##V; \
_RvMap##K##V *_rvMapConstruct##K##V(_RvMap##K##V *map, RvAlloc *a); \
void _rvMapSetValue##K##V(_RvMap##K##V *map, const K *key, const V *value); \
const V *_rvMapGetValue##K##V(const _RvMap##K##V *map, const K *key); \
V *_rvMapFindValue##K##V(_RvMap##K##V *map, const K *key); \
void _rvMapRemove##K##V(_RvMap##K##V *map, const K *key); \
_RvMapIter##K##V _rvMapBegin##K##V(const _RvMap##K##V *map); \
_RvMapIter##K##V _rvMapEnd##K##V(const _RvMap##K##V *map); \
_RvMapRevIter##K##V _rvMapRevBegin##K##V(const _RvMap##K##V *map); \
_RvMapRevIter##K##V _rvMapRevEnd##K##V(const _RvMap##K##V *map); \
const K *_rvMapIterGetKey##K##V(_RvMapIter##K##V iter); \
V *_rvMapIterGetValue##K##V(_RvMapIter##K##V iter); \
const K *_rvMapRevIterGetKey##K##V(_RvMapRevIter##K##V iter); \
V *_rvMapRevIterGetValue##K##V(_RvMapRevIter##K##V iter);
#define rvDefineMap(K, V) \
void rvKeyConstructCopy##K##V(void *d, const void *s, RvAlloc *a) { K##ConstructCopy((K *)d, (const K *)s, a); } \
void rvValueConstructCopy##K##V(void *d, const void *s, RvAlloc *a) { V##ConstructCopy((V *)d, (const V *)s, a); } \
void rvKeyDestruct##K##V(void *x) { K##Destruct((K *)x); } \
void rvValueDestruct##K##V(void *x) { V##Destruct((V *)x); } \
RvBool rvKeyLess##K##V(const void *a, const void *b) { return K##Less((const K *)a, (const K *)b); } \
RvBool rvKeyEqual##K##V(const void *a, const void *b) { return K##Equal((const K *)a, (const K *)b); } \
RvTreeInfo rvTreeInfo##K##V = {sizeof(K), sizeof(V), rvKeyConstructCopy##K##V, rvValueConstructCopy##K##V, \
rvKeyDestruct##K##V, rvValueDestruct##K##V, rvKeyLess##K##V, rvKeyEqual##K##V}; \
_RvMap##K##V *_rvMapConstruct##K##V(_RvMap##K##V *map, RvAlloc *a) { rvTreeConstruct(&map->tree, a, &rvTreeInfo##K##V); return map; } \
void _rvMapSetValue##K##V(_RvMap##K##V *map, const K *key, const V *value) { rvTreeSetValue(&map->tree, key, value); } \
const V *_rvMapGetValue##K##V(const _RvMap##K##V *map, const K *key) { return (const V *)rvTreeGetValue(&map->tree, key); } \
V *_rvMapFindValue##K##V(_RvMap##K##V *map, const K *key) { return (V *)rvTreeFindValue(&map->tree, key); } \
void _rvMapRemove##K##V(_RvMap##K##V *map, const K *key) { rvTreeRemove(&map->tree, key); } \
_RvMapIter##K##V _rvMapBegin##K##V(const _RvMap##K##V *map) { return rvTreeBegin(&map->tree); } \
_RvMapIter##K##V _rvMapEnd##K##V(const _RvMap##K##V *map) { return rvTreeEnd(&map->tree); } \
_RvMapRevIter##K##V _rvMapRevBegin##K##V(const _RvMap##K##V *map) { return rvTreeRevBegin(&map->tree); } \
_RvMapRevIter##K##V _rvMapRevEnd##K##V(const _RvMap##K##V *map) { return rvTreeRevEnd(&map->tree); } \
const K *_rvMapIterGetKey##K##V(_RvMapIter##K##V iter) { return (const K *)rvTreeIterGetKey(iter); } \
V *_rvMapIterGetValue##K##V(_RvMapIter##K##V iter) { return (V *)rvTreeIterGetValue(iter, &rvTreeInfo##K##V); } \
const K *_rvMapRevIterGetKey##K##V(_RvMapRevIter##K##V iter) { return (const K *)rvTreeRevIterGetKey(iter); } \
V *_rvMapRevIterGetValue##K##V(_RvMapRevIter##K##V iter) { return (V *)rvTreeRevIterGetValue(iter, &rvTreeInfo##K##V); }
#define rvMapConstruct(K, V) _rvMapConstruct##K##V
#define rvMapDestruct(map) rvTreeDestruct(&(map)->tree)
#define rvMapConstructCopy(d, s, a) rvTreeConstructCopy(&(d)->tree, &(s)->tree, (a))
#define rvMapCopy(d, s) rvTreeCopy(&(d)->tree, &(s)->tree)
#define rvMapSetValue(K, V) _rvMapSetValue##K##V
#define rvMapGetValue(K, V) _rvMapGetValue##K##V
#define rvMapFindValue(K, V) _rvMapFindValue##K##V
#define rvMapRemove(K, V) _rvMapRemove##K##V
#define rvMapSize(map) rvTreeSize(&(map)->tree)
#define rvMapClear(map) rvTreeClear(&(map)->tree)
#define rvMapGetAllocator(map) rvTreeGetAllocator(&(map)->tree)
#define rvMapBegin(K, V) _rvMapBegin##K##V
#define rvMapEnd(K, V) _rvMapEnd##K##V
#define rvMapRevBegin(K, V) _rvMapRevBegin##K##V
#define rvMapRevEnd(K, V) _rvMapRevEnd##K##V
/* Forward iterator */
#define rvMapIterNext rvTreeIterNext
#define rvMapIterPrev rvTreeIterPrev
#define rvMapIterEqual(a,b) rvTreeIterEqual((a),(b))
#define rvMapIterCopy(a,b) rvTreeIterCopy((a),(b))
#define rvMapIterGetKey(K, V) _rvMapIterGetKey##K##V
#define rvMapIterGetValue(K, V) _rvMapIterGetValue##K##V
/* Reverse iterator */
#define rvMapRevIterNext rvTreeRevIterNext
#define rvMapRevIterPrev rvTreeRevIterPrev
#define rvMapRevIterEqual(a,b) rvTreeRevIterEqual((a),(b))
#define rvMapRevIterCopy(a,b) rvTreeRevIterCopy((a),(b))
#define rvMapRevIterGetKey(K, V) _rvMapRevIterGetKey##K##V
#define rvMapRevIterGetValue(K, V) _rvMapRevIterGetValue##K##V
#define RvMap(K, V) _RvMap##K##V
#define RvMapIter(K, V) _RvMapIter##K##V
#define RvMapRevIter(K, V) _RvMapRevIter##K##V
#endif
